Washington County Property Search

Washington County property records provide data about a local property's legal ownership, boundaries, assessment and taxation, and transactions. Property record searches are necessary to locate property records.

One of the primary purposes of a property record search is to ensure the legality of real estate transactions. Prospective buyers, sellers, investors, and local government agencies rely on these records to make informed decisions. For instance, homebuyers use property records to verify the legitimacy of a property's title before making a purchase, while county assessors use the records to determine property tax assessments.

In Washington County, property records are typically dispensed by the Assessment and Taxation Department. This office maintains and updates property records, ensuring their accuracy and accessibility to the public. The department offers a variety of tools and resources for property record searches, including online databases and in-person assistance, making it convenient for individuals and professionals to access vital information about real estate within the county.

Are Washington County Property Records Public?

Yes. In Washington County, property records are considered public information under the Oregon Public Records Law. Under this law, every person has the right to inspect any public record of a public body, subject to certain limitations. Exemptions include situations where disclosure would invade personal privacy and when a record is protected by law.

In practice, most property records, such as deeds, ownership information, and property assessments, are considered public records and are accessible to the public. However, specific details, such as an individual's Social Security Number and other sensitive personal information, may be redacted or restricted to protect privacy. Section 192.345 of the Oregon Revised Statutes contains the Washington FOIA's exemptions.

What Do Washington County Property Records Contain?

Property records in Washington County typically contain various information about real estate properties within the county, including:

  • General Property Information: This includes the names and contact details of the property owner(s), physical address, legal description (often described by plat maps, sections, and township), and the parcel number or tax ID.
  • Assessment Information: The property's assessed value for tax purposes, which may include land and building values.
  • Building and Improvement Details: Information about structures on the property, such as the number of bedrooms and bathrooms, square footage, and any additions or improvements made to the property.
  • Recorded Instruments: Copies of deeds, mortgages, and other legal documents recorded in the Assessment and Taxation Department's Recording Office.
  • Sales History: Records of past property sales, including sale prices and dates.

Where to Perform a Washington County Property Lookup

The Assessment & Taxation Department is the primary destination for conducting property searches in Washington County. The office has an online search tool that facilitates convenient access to property-related information, making it valuable to homeowners, potential buyers, or anyone interested in property within the county.

Individuals can also visit the Washington County Assessment & Taxation Office in person to search for property records.

How to Perform a Property Owner Lookup in Washington County

Requesters can obtain property ownership information online and in person in Washington County.

An individual interested in a property search online should navigate to the official website of the Washington County Assessment & Taxation Office and select "Property Information". The user will be provided with different search criteria on the next page, including a property address, tax lot ID, and property identifier. Accessible records include the property's assessed value, tax details, ownership records, and other related data.

The County of Washington also offers GIS maps with property information. These maps visually represent property lines, and individuals can often click on specific parcels to find ownership details.

On the other hand, if a person prefers in-person searches, they can visit the Washington County Assessment and Taxation Office during regular business hours. The office is located at 155 North First Avenue, Hillsboro, Oregon. Staff members can assist requesters with property owner lookups, provide access to paper property records, and answer any questions.

Washington County Property Tax Lookup

Property tax information is often needed in different scenarios, such as when people want to buy or sell real estate, assess their financial obligations, or review a property's tax status.

Individuals may access the Washington County Assessment and Taxation's Property Information portal to look up tax details. The Assessment and Taxation Office is responsible for collecting taxes for the county and storing related records. As mentioned, the portal can be searched by property address, tax lot ID, or property identifier. After each successful inquiry, the system will generate a report of a property's assessed value, current and past tax amounts, applied exemptions, and payment due dates.

How to Find Washington County Property Appraiser

Residents can find a property appraiser in Washington County through the Appraiser Certification and Licensure Board (ACLB). The Board has a Public Record Search tool that interested persons can search by profession, county, license number, name, or license expiration date. Search results include the complete names, addresses, contact numbers, and licensee information of real estate appraisers in Washington County.

Real estate appraisers in Washington County provide services that include assessing the value of properties for various purposes, such as buying or selling real estate, securing loans, estate planning, and property tax assessments. Their primary function is to provide accurate and unbiased property valuations to help clients make informed real estate decisions.

Washington County Property Assessor

The Washington County Property Assessor determines the assessed value of all taxable properties within the county, including residential, commercial, and industrial properties. This estimated value is used to calculate property taxes for each property owner.

The assessor in Washington County plays a vital role in ensuring the fair and equitable distribution of property taxes by assessing properties at their current market value. The office also handles property tax exemptions and deductions, maintains property records, and addresses property assessment and taxation inquiries.

Individuals can contact the Washington County Property Assessor at the address below.

Washington County Assessment & Taxation
155 North First Avenue
Suite 130 MS8
Hillsboro, OR 97124
Phone: (503) 846-8741
Email: at@washingtoncountyor.gov
